Beaumetz (Picard: Bieumé) is a commune in the Somme department in Hauts-de-France in northern France.

Geography

[edit]

Beaumetz is situated at the junction of the D185 and D925 roads, some 20 miles (32 km) east of Abbeville. It is surrounded by the communes Ribeaucourt, Prouville and Domesmont.

Population

[edit]
Historical population
YearPop.±% p.a.
1968 198    
1975 191−0.51%
1982 167−1.90%
1990 157−0.77%
1999 170+0.89%
2007 199+1.99%
2012 230+2.94%
2017 226−0.35%
2023 215−0.83%
Source: INSEE[3]
